Purpose of Position: Perform all material handling duties in the department including moving all materials, ordering materials, relieving operators, disposal of trash and scrap, and tracking production.

 

Major Responsibilities:

  • Complete transactions in PeopleSoft, label making, various software programs (production databases), line openings and defect reporting programs on the computer.
  • Write up rejects in AIMS
  • Scan finished and WIP products, order materials and make returns to the warehouse.
  • Follow proper procedures for production reporting.
  • Move materials using pallet jacks, electric powered pallet jacks, tote dollies and push carts.
  • Place and retrieve skids.
  • Wrap skids with film to ensure skid integrity.
  • Follow established operating procedures for managing WIP and finished goods.
  • Save product samples for traceability.
  • Supply operators with any items needed throughout the shift (practice FIFO).
  • When needed empty trash cans throughout the department, collect and dispose of all corrugated using outside corrugated compactor, empty dumpsters into outside trash compactor.
  • Follow good housekeeping procedures.
  • Perform operator functions in a backfill capacity.
  • Report to supervisor any defective materials or unsafe conditions that occur.
  • Use good communication and team skills.
  • Perform other duties as assigned by supervisor.
